Message type: E = Error
Message class: SIT2_DESIGN_TIME - Situation Handling Design Time Messages
Message number: 023
Message text: Situation description exceeds the length of 255 characters.

- Situation description exceeds the length of 255 characters. ?The SAP error message SIT2_DESIGN_TIME023 indicates that a situation description exceeds the maximum allowed length of 255 characters. This error typically occurs in the context of SAP Solution Manager or other SAP applications where situation definitions or alerts are being created or modified.

To resolve this error, you can take the following steps:
Shorten the Description: Review the situation description you are trying to enter and reduce its length to 255 characters or fewer. Focus on the most critical information that needs to be conveyed.
Use Abbreviations: If possible, use abbreviations or shorthand for terms that are commonly understood within your organization to save space.
Split Information: If the situation requires more detailed information, consider splitting the description into multiple parts or using additional fields if available.
Check for Configuration Settings: If you are consistently running into this issue, check if there are any configuration settings that can be adjusted to allow for longer descriptions, although this is less common.
